Here’s what the court said: The Court declines to find, as a matter of law, that a single instance of a noose displayed in the workplace, arguably directed at a particular African American employee who had complained of race discrimination, is insufficiently severe to support a retaliatory hostile work environment claim…The noose alone qualifies as an extremely serious act of harassment based on race and is meant to convey a threat of physical harm and to arouse fear in the… [read post]

Matter of Alejandro MORENO-ESCOBOSA, 25 I&N Dec. 114 (BIA 2009) The Board of Immigration Appeals has sustained the appeal of a Green Card holder who is a native and citizen of Mexico, and the father of four United States citizen children. [read post]

The Board of Immigration Appeals has just issued a new decision entitled Matter of Rajah, Interim Decision #3662, 25 I&N Dec. 127 (BIA 2009) The case involves a native and citizen of Morocco that came to the United States on December 13, 1994 as a visitor. [read post]

Yesterday, the 4th Circuit Court of Appeals joined the 3rd, 8th, and 11th circuits in rejecting the Attorney General's decision in Matter of Silva-Trevino, 24 I & N Dec. 687, 688-90 (A.G. 2008). [read post]
